5. The Evil Dead

Evil Dead Trilogy

We had to start off with something horror related, y’all know that! These three cult classics feature the legendary Bruce Campbell as “Ash” fighting off hoardes of evil brought on by the Book of the Dead. If you haven’t seen them, you most definitely should, especially since we hear a remake is on the way.

2. The Godfather

The Godfather Trilogy

You know we had to put The Godfather trilogy on here! These three are widely considered to be one of the best film series of all time, and we can’t think of a good enough reason to disagree. Francis Ford Coppola directed these three depictions of Mario Puzo’s famous novels following the Corleone crime family, a group of badass Italians that pretty much ran shit. If you like mob dealings and gore, there probably aren’t 3 movies you should see more.
